In this bento I have shredded cheddar cheese (in the cap of a small tupperware type container--I need to get some of those silicone baking cups), an apple cut like a bunny (tutorial from Lunch in a Box), leftover chicken nuggets from Chick-fil-A. The box part has raisins, more apple slices (I soaked them in water with Splenda and lemon juice to keep from browning), and these really yummy graham cereal things from Trader Joes. AND it has 8 grams of fiber per serving. They taste good and have lots fiber? Wow, what more could you want.
Sophia only ate the raisins and some of the cereal. I think looking at all the food was overwhelming. They're just meant to be snacks as she munches throughout the day. However, when she saw the bento all nice and pretty, she was in love. "WOW," she exclaimed. Rubbing her hands together gleefully, she then says, "The best present E-ver!" Now that's a winning endorsement. I think the packaging did make the food more exciting for her.
